Introduction to Structure and Materials

Our company offers high-quality Teflon hoses. Here is a brief introduction to each layer and its features:

1. PTFE Inner Tube

The innermost layer of our hose is made from pure PTFE material. This ensures excellent chemical resistance and smooth flow of fluids. The PTFE inner tube has remarkable high-temperature resistance, capable of withstanding temperatures up to 260 degrees Celsius. This makes it ideal for applications involving hot fluids or gases. Additionally, its non-stick properties prevent material buildup, ensuring consistent performance over time.

2. Stainless Steel Braiding

The second layer consists of stainless steel braiding, which provides mechanical strength and durability to the hose. We use either 304 or 316 stainless steel wires for braiding, depending on the specific requirements of the application. This braiding enhances the hose’s ability to withstand higher pressures, making it suitable for demanding industrial environments. The stainless steel also adds corrosion resistance, further extending the hose’s service life.

3. Optional Layers

To further customize our PTFE hoses, we offer optional outer layers. These can include materials such as PU (polyurethane), PVC (polyvinyl chloride), or silicone. These outer layers provide additional protection against abrasion, UV exposure, and other environmental factors. For example, a silicone outer layer can enhance the hose’s flexibility and high-temperature resistance, making it suitable for applications where both heat and flexibility are critical.

Key Performance Parameters

This is our best-selling series. Please refer to the specifications and data. 

No. Inner diameter Outer diameter Tube Wall
Thickness
Working pressure Burst pressure Minimum bending radius Specification sleeve size
(inch) (mm±0.2) (inch) (mm±0.2) (inch) (mm±0.1) (psi) (bar) (psi) (bar) (inch) (mm)
ZXGM111-03 1/8″ 3.5 0.220 5.6 0.039 1.00 3582 247 14326 988 2.008 51 -2 ZXTF0-02
ZXGM111-04  3/16″  4.8  0.315 8.0  0.033  0.85  2936  203  11745  810 2.953 75  -3  ZXTF0-03
ZXGM111-05  1/4″  6.4  0.362  9.2  0.033  0.85  2646  183  10585  730  3.189  81  -4  ZXTF0-04
ZXGM111-06  5/16″  8.0  0.433  11.0  0.033  0.85  2429  168  9715  670  3.622 92  -5  ZXTF0-05
ZXGM111-07  3/8″  9.5  0.512  13.0  0.033  0.85 1958   135  7830  540  4.331  110  -6  ZXTF0-06
ZXGM111-08  13/32″  10.3  0.531  13.5  0.033  0.85  1894 128  7395  510  5.157  131  -7  ZXTF0-06
ZXGM111-10  1/2″  12.7  0.630  16.0  0.039  1.00  2272  113  6818  450  7.165  182  -8  ZXTF0-08
ZXGM111-12 5/8″  16.0  0.756  19.2  0.039  1.00 1233  85  4930  340 8.307  211  -10  ZXTF0-10
ZXGM111-14 3/4″ 19.0  0.902  22.9  0.039  1.00 1051 73  4205 290 13.307 338  -12  ZXTF0-12
ZXGM111-16  7/8″ 22.2  1.031 26.2  0.039  1.00 870 60  3480  240 16.575 421  -14  ZXTF0-14
ZXGM111-18    1″  25.0  1.161  29.5  0.059  1.50  798 55  3190  220  21.220  539  -16  ZXTF0-16
ZXGM111-20  1-1/8″  28.0  1.299 33.0  0.059  1.50  725  50  2900  200  23.622  600  -18  ZXTF0-18
ZXGM111-22  1-1/4″  32.0  1.496  38.0  0.079  2.00  653  45  2610 180  27.559  700  -20  ZXTF0-20
ZXGM111-26 1-1/2″ 38.0 1.732 44.0 0.079  2.00 580 40 2320 160 31.496 800 -24 ZXTF0-24
ZXGM111-32   2″ 50.0 2.224 56.5 0.079  2.00 435 30 1740 120 39.961 1015 -32 ZXTF0-32

* Meet SAE 100R14 standard.
